HONOREE FROM WASHINGTON AND LEE UNIVERSITY
  • Standout W&L Athlete: Served as captain of the last subsidized football team in 1953, earning two honorable mention All-America selections at center and playing in both the Blue-Gray All-Star Game and the College All-Star
  • Professional Recognition: Drafted in the sixth round by the Washington Redskins; also earned three varsity letters in lacrosse at W&L
  • Coaching & Administrative Career: Built a successful career at Pennsylvania Military College (now Widener), Williams College, and Lebanon Valley College before returning to W&L
  • Leadership at W&L: Served as athletic director and chairman of the physical education department from 1971 to 1989, holding prominent leadership roles in the USILA, Virginia Sports Hall of Fame, ODAC, and NCAA Division III Football Committee
  • Football Coaching Tenure: Led W&L’s football program from 1973–77, with a highlight 1976 season finishing 5-5 after winning four of the last five games
  • Later Career: Concluded his athletics career as athletic director at the College of Wooster from 1991 until his retirement in 1996
